BE IT ORDAINED BY TH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F WATERLOO, IOWA:
That Subsection 2A -19A, Landscaping Regulations, is hereby added to
Part IX, "R-3" Multiple Residence District, of the City of
Waterloo, Iowa, Zoning Ordinance No. 2479, as amended, as follows:
2A -19A LANDSCAPING REGULATIONS
This part shall apply to the following activities for all "R-3" or
less restrictive uses; except those located in the "C-3" zone,
which engage in one or more of the following:
1. new construction
2. expansion of an existing building equal to 10% or 1000
square feet whichever is less
3. new or expanded parking areas
A. LANDSCAPE AREA AND PLANTING REQUIREMENTS
Developments requiring landscaping under this part shall provide
one of the following combinations of landscaped area and planting
points per square foot of total lot area:

The point schedule in Part XVIII (A) Sec. 2A -43A; F2 shall be used
in determining points for required planting:
A minimum of 65 percent of all required points shall be
achieved through tree plantings.
The points required per square foot of vehicular use area shall be
placed within islands in the vehicular use area and/or within five
feet (5') of the perimeter. The intent is to position the
plantings to enhance the overall appearance of the site.
All trees within the vehicular use area shall be two inch (2")
caliper or greater measured six inches (6") above grade at the time
of planting.
B. STREET TREE PLANTING
A minimum of 1.5 points per linear foot of street frontage
must be achieved in the City parking strip. This point requirement
shall be met through the provision of trees, and planting shall
comply with the Vegetation Ordinance Chapter 35 of the Waterloo
Municipal Code. If circumstances do not allow planting on the city
parking, street tree points shall be placed in the street yard
setback area.

D. LARGE SITES
For sites larger than two acres in area, the City Planner or
his/her designated representative may recommend approval of a
variance to the Board of Adjustment if he/she determines that the
landscaping provided meets the intent of this section.
E. MAINTENANCE
The owner shall be solely responsible for the maintenance of any
and all landscaping. This maintenance shall include but not be
limited to, removal of litter, pruning, mowing of lawns, adequate
watering for all growing plant life, and also weeding in accordance
with the Tree and Shrub Care Guidelines as set forth by the
Waterloo Park Commission. The Owner shall also be responsible for
any replacement, as necessary, in order to preserve the landscaping
plan as approved by this section. The responsibility to maintain
the landscaping shall include the parking strip located between the
private property line and the public street or highway, directly
adjacent to the owner's property. A maintenance and right to enter
agreement shall be signed prior to a building permit being issued.
F. SUBMITTAL REQUIREMENTS
Submittal for landscape approval shall include a separate planting
plan showing type, size, and number of plantings; a site plan
showing total area and total landscaped area and any supplementary
information as required to demonstrate conformance to the landscape
requirements. Any deviations from the approved landscape plan must
receive approval from the City Planner or his/her designated
representative prior to installation.

2A-45 OFF-STREET PARKING AREA REQUIRED
B.
General Requirements
8. It is desirable that all parking areas be aesthetically
improved to reduce obtrusive characteristics such as
those inherent to their uses. Whenever practical, such
parking areas shall be effectively screened from general
public view by incorporating the natural landscaping and
topography with introduction of additional planting and
grading to accomplish this desire.
All parking areas for more than four (4) spaces shall
include landscape areas, equal to not less than five
percent (5%) of the total paved area. The required
landscape area shall be located:
1) within the vehicular use area;
2) within five feet (5') of the perimeter;
3) added to a street yard building buffer area;
4) in the street yard setback area.
